If you are planning a visit down to Ayrshire, make sure you don't miss out by dining at Ayrshires best kept secret - The Loudoun Hill Inn. It is situated on the main A71 road between Strathaven and Darvel facing the Loudoun Hill. From the outside it could be simply any side of the road pub restaurant. Once you are inside you quickly realise that this place could easily compete with some of the top UK restaurants. The food is absolutely delicious! The food and presentation is on a par to a few michelin star restaurants that I have been to, but without the high prices. For example, a braised shoulder of lamb on a bed of mash will set you back less than £15, but for the way it tastes you would easily part with more cash for it. The staff are very friendly and go out of their way to make you feel like their main priority and help create a relaxing atmosphere in which to dine. It is an ideal location for anyone seeking to impress someone special without spending a fortune like you do in Glasgow or Edinburgh.
